Man arrested in domestic violence incident involving firearms in Boston

1 min read

BOSTON, MA — Boston police arrested a male suspect in a domestic violence incident where firearms were involved.

The Boston Police Department highlighted the dangers officers face when responding to domestic violence calls, which are among the most dangerous 911 calls officers encounter daily.

Police did not release the suspect’s name or specific details about the incident.

Resources are available for those experiencing domestic violence, including the Asian Task Force Against Domestic Violence, Association of Haitian Women in Boston, Boston Area Rape Crisis Center, Casa Myrna Vasquez and Massachusetts Alliance of Portuguese Speakers.
